The Belfast Rotary Club is once again organizing an event for collecting and recycling old and broken electronics. Electronic waste will be accepted on Saturday, September 18, from 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. at the Belfast Public Works Dept. Parking Lot on 55 Congress Street .This event is open to residents from any community and items may be recycled for free.

The Belfast Rotary Club is partnering with eWaste Recycling Solutions LLC (ERS) of Auburn, which will bring a team to pack and transport televisions, computers, monitors, and other electronic devices. ERS, which is approved by the Department of Environmental Protection, will have staff at the collection site at no cost to the Belfast Rotary Club. Club members, Youth Exchange students from around the world, and high school students will help with traffic and unloading vehicles.

The primary focus is on collecting electronic devices and other universal waste including: televisions, CPUs, monitors, copiers, printers, ink cartridges, fax machines, scanners, laptops, stereos, key board-mouse-peripherals, DVD players, cell phones, remote controls, VCRs, projectors, digital cameras, tape players, PDAs, speakers, telephones, two-way radios, answering machines, camcorders, CD players, electric typewriters, game systems, pagers, microwaves, and toner cartridges.
